1.4.0

**December 4, 2015**

Over the past few months we have added several major new features and
with the help of our users have been able to address a number of bugs
and inconsistencies. We have closed 57 issues and added over 1100 new
commits.

Major new features:

- Data API: The new data API brings an extensible system of to add new
data interfaces to column based Element types. These interfaces
allow applying powerful operations on the data independently of the
data format. The currently supported datatypes include NumPy, pandas
dataframes and a simple dictionary format. ([PR
\284](https://github.com/pyviz/holoviews/pull/284))
- Backend API: In this release we completely refactored the rendering,
plotting and IPython display system to make it easy to add new
plotting backends. Data may be styled and pickled for each backend
independently and renderers now support exporting all plotting data
including widgets as standalone HTML files or with separate
JSON data.
- Bokeh backend: The first new plotting backend added via the new
backend API. Bokeh plots allow for much faster plotting and
greater interactivity. Supports most Element types and layouts and
provides facilities for sharing axes across plots and linked
brushing across plots. ([PR
\250](https://github.com/pyviz/holoviews/pull/250))
- DynamicMap: The new DynamicMap class allows HoloMap data to be
generated on-the-fly while running a Jupyter IPython
notebook kernel. Allows visualization of unbounded data streams and
smooth exploration of large continuous parameter spaces. ([PR
\278](https://github.com/pyviz/holoviews/pull/278))

Other features:

- Easy definition of custom aliases for group, label and Dimension
names, allowing easier use of LaTeX.
- New Trisurface and QuadMesh elements.
- Widgets now allow expressing hierarchical relationships
between dimensions.
- Added GridMatrix container for heterogeneous Elements and gridmatrix
operation to generate scatter matrix showing relationship
between dimensions.
- Filled contour regions can now be generated using the
contours operation.
- Consistent indexing semantics for all Elements and support for
boolean indexing for Columns and NdMapping types.
- New hv.notebook_extension function offers a more flexible
alternative to %load_ext, e.g. for loading other
extensions hv.notebook_extension(bokeh=True).

Experimental features:

- Bokeh callbacks allow adding interactivity by communicating between
BokehJS tools and the IPython kernel, e.g. allowing downsampling
based on the zoom level.

Notable bug fixes:

- Major speedup rendering large HoloMaps (\~ 2-3 times faster).
- Colorbars now consistent for all plot configurations.
- Style pickling now works correctly.

API Changes:

- Dimension formatter parameter now deprecated in favor
of value_format.
- Types of Chart and Table Element data now dependent on
selected interface.
- DFrame conversion interface deprecated in favor of Columns
pandas interface.

1.3.2

**July 6, 2015**

Minor bugfix release to address a small number of issues:

Features:

- Added support for colorbars on Surface Element (1cd5281).
- Added linewidth style option to SurfacePlot (9b6ccc5).

Bug fixes:

- Fixed inversion inversion of y-range during sampling (6ff81bb).
- Fixed overlaying of 3D elements (787d511).
- Ensuring that underscore.js is loaded in widgets (f2f6378).
- Fixed Python3 issue in Overlay.get (8ceabe3).

1.3.1

**July 1, 2015**

Minor bugfix release to address a number of issues that weren't caught
in time for the 1.3.0 release with the addition of a small number of
features:

Features:

- Introduced new `Spread` element to plot errors and confidence
intervals (30d3184).
- `ErrorBars` and `Spread` elements now allow most Chart constructor
types (f013deb).

Bug fixes:

- Fixed unicode handling for dimension labels (061e9af).
- Handling of invalid dimension label characters in widgets (a101b9e).
- Fixed setting of fps option for MPLRenderer video output (c61b9df).
- Fix for multiple and animated colorbars (5e1e4b5).
- Fix to Chart slices starting or ending at zero (edd0039).

1.3

1.3.0

**June 27, 2015**

Since the last release we closed over 34 issues and have made 380
commits mostly focused on fixing bugs, cleaning up the API and working
extensively on the plotting and rendering system to ensure HoloViews is
fully backend independent.

We'd again like to thank our growing user base for all their input,
which has helped us in making the API more understandable and fixing a
number of important bugs.

Highlights/Features:

- Allowed display of data structures which do not match the
recommended nesting hierarchy (67b28f3, fbd89c3).
- Dimensions now sanitized for `.select`, `.sample` and `.reduce`
calls (6685633, 00b5a66).
- Added `holoviews.ipython.display` function to render (and display)
any HoloViews object, useful for IPython interact widgets (0fa49cd).
- Table column widths now adapt to cell contents (be90a54).
- Defaulting to Matplotlib ticking behavior (62e1e58).
- Allowed specifying fixed figure sizes to Matplotlib via `fig_inches`
tuples using (width, None) and (None, height) formats (632facd).
- Constructors of `Chart`, `Path` and `Histogram` classes now support
additional data formats (2297375).
- `ScrubberWidget` now supports all figure formats (c317db4).
- Allowed customizing legend positions on `Bars` Elements (5a12882).
- Support for multiple colorbars on one axis (aac7b92).
- `.reindex` on `NdElement` types now support converting between key
and value dimensions allowing more powerful conversions. (03ac3ce)
- Improved support for casting between `Element` types (cdaab4e,
b2ad91b, ce7fe2d, 865b4d5).
- The `%%opts` cell magic may now be used multiple times in the same
cell (2a77fd0)
- Matplotlib rcParams can now be set correctly per figure (751210f).
- Improved `OptionTree` repr which now works with eval (2f824c1).
- Refactor of rendering system and IPython extension to allow easy
swapping of plotting backend (\141)
- Large plotting optimization by computing tight `bbox_inches`
once (e34e339).
- Widgets now cache frames in the DOM, avoiding flickering in some
browsers and make use of jinja2 template inheritance. (fc7dd2b)
- Calling a HoloViews object without arguments now clears any
associated custom styles. (9e8c343)

API Changes

- Renamed key_dimensions and value_dimensions to kdims and vdims
respectively, while providing backward compatibility for passing and
accessing the long names (8feb7d2).
- Combined x/y/zticker plot options into x/y/zticks parameters which
now accept an explicit number of ticks, an explicit list of tick
positions (and labels), and a Matplotlib tick locator.
- Changed backend options in %output magic, `nbagg` and `d3` are now
modes of the Matplotlib backend and can be selected with
`backend='matplotlib:nbagg'` and
`backend='matplotlib:mpld3'` respectively. The 'd3' and 'nbagg'
options remain supported but will be deprecated in future.
- Customizations should no longer be applied directly to
`Store.options`; the `Store.options(backend='matplotlib')` object
should be customized instead. There is no longer a need to call the
deprecated `Store.register_plots` method.
